In this episode, Ourdadsstamps look at the stamps that have been produced to commemorate the Chinese New Year, and look for reasons why the Golden Monkey stamp of 1980 is so scarce even though 5 million were issued.

In this presentation by the Winnipeg Philatelic Society, they look at the German hyperinflation postage stamps from 1922 and 1923 and the hyperinflation itself are discussed. All the hyperinflation stamps between May and December 1923 are shown along with a representative group of the stamps between 1920 and May 1923.
